WebOct 13, 2024 · Drainage Basins as open systems. The drainage basin is the area of land drained by a river system (a river and its tributaries). It includes the surface run-off in the water cycle, as well as the water found in the ground. Drainage basins are separated by watersheds. This is the area that separates on drainage basin from another, indeed, the ... A stalactite hangs like an icicle from the ceiling or sides of a cavern. A stalagmite appears like an inverted stalactite, rising from the floor of a cavern.
